2004 Audi Allroad vs. 1956 Moretti 1200
To start off, 2004 Audi Allroad is newer by 48 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1956 Moretti 1200.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1956 Moretti 1200 would be higher. At 4,163 cc (8 cylinders), 2004 Audi Allroad is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Audi Allroad (300 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 232 more horse power than 1956 Moretti 1200. (68 HP @ 7000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Audi Allroad should accelerate faster than 1956 Moretti 1200.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Audi Allroad weights approximately 1369 kg more than 1956 Moretti 1200.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Because 2004 Audi Allroad is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1956 Moretti 1200.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Audi Allroad will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
Compare all specifications:
2004 Audi Allroad | 1956 Moretti 1200 | |
Make | Audi | Moretti |
Model | Allroad | 1200 |
Year Released | 2004 | 1956 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4163 cc | 1204 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 5 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 300 HP | 68 HP |
Engine RPM | 6200 RPM | 7000 RPM |
Drive Type | 4WD | Rear |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 2 seats |
Number of Doors | 5 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1944 kg | 575 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4820 mm | 3810 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1940 mm | 1510 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1580 mm | 1430 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2660 mm | 2360 mm |
